<- back to home # Experience Feb. 2024 - Present Aug. 2023 - May. 2024
CS Peer Tutor & Operating Systems Teaching Assistant
May. 2023 - Jul. 2023 Jan. 2023 - May. 2023
Program Design & Abstraction Teaching Assistant
# Projects
Developed a UNIX shell clone in C; implemented internal commands like 'cd', 'help', 'echo', etc.
A simple CHIP-8 emulator written in C++ . Pretty much a beginner emulation project.
A follow up emulation project that i'm currently working on. Also written in C++ .
Hackathon project. Inquiry is a multi-platform real-time messaging and reaction app for students to ask questions without the fear of public opinion. Uses Typescript, Next, Electron, and Supabase.
# Skills ## Used Often - C / C++ - Typescript - Python ## Used Occasionally - ASM: MIPS, x86, GBZ80, 6502 - Rust - C# ## Tools & Technologies I Use Frequently - Build Tools: GNU Make, CMake, Cargo, Ninja
- Databases: SQL, SQLite, PostGreSQL
- Game Engines: Godot
- Editors: Vim
- Typesetters: Markdown, Typst, LaTeX
Copyright (c) Devin Rankin 2025. All rights reserved.